1956 AL Shortstop Range Factor Leaders
Putouts plus assists per game at shortstop
Don Buddin led the AL in shortstop range factor in 1956 with 5.16, 0.40 ahead of Luis Aparicio (4.76). It was one of 2 times Don Buddin led in shortstop range factor.
Showing players with at least 104 games at the position — the fielding-title rule of two-thirds of the team's games. Show all players
